.about-page{background-color:var(--surface);width:100vw;overflow-x:hidden}.about-hero{background-color:#020617;align-items:center;height:60vh;min-height:500px;display:flex;position:relative}.about-hero-bg{z-index:0;width:100%;height:100%;position:absolute;top:0;left:0}.about-hero-img{object-fit:cover;width:100%;height:100%}.about-hero-overlay{z-index:1;background:linear-gradient(90deg,#020617f2 0%,#020617bf 50%,#0206174d 100%);width:100%;height:100%;position:absolute;top:0;left:0}.about-hero-content{z-index:2;color:#fff;width:92%;max-width:1600px;margin:60px auto 0;position:relative}.about-title{color:#fff;letter-spacing:-1px;margin-bottom:1rem;font-size:clamp(3rem,5vw,4.5rem);font-weight:900}.about-subtitle{color:#cbd5e1;max-width:800px;font-size:clamp(1.15rem,1.5vw,1.35rem);line-height:1.7}.story-grid{grid-template-columns:1fr 1fr;align-items:center;gap:5rem;padding:6rem 0;display:grid}.story-text h2{color:#0f172a;margin-bottom:1.5rem;font-size:2.5rem;font-weight:800}.story-text p{color:#475569;margin-bottom:1.5rem;font-size:1.15rem;line-height:1.8}.story-image-wrapper{border-radius:12px;width:100%;height:500px;overflow:hidden;box-shadow:0 25px 50px -12px #00000040}.story-image{object-fit:cover;width:100%;height:100%}.values-section{background-color:#0f172a;padding:7rem 0}.values-header{text-align:center;margin-bottom:5rem}.values-label{text-transform:uppercase;letter-spacing:3px;color:#38bdf8;margin-bottom:1rem;font-size:.85rem;font-weight:700;display:inline-block}.values-title{color:#fff;text-align:center;margin-bottom:1.25rem;font-size:2.75rem;font-weight:800}.values-subtitle{color:#94a3b8;max-width:600px;margin:0 auto;font-size:1.15rem;line-height:1.7}.values-timeline{flex-direction:column;gap:0;max-width:900px;margin:0 auto;display:flex}.value-item{align-items:stretch;gap:2.5rem;padding:2.5rem 0;display:flex;position:relative}.value-item+.value-item{border-top:1px solid #ffffff0f}.value-number{background:linear-gradient(135deg,#38bdf8,#0056b3);-webkit-text-fill-color:transparent;opacity:.35;-webkit-user-select:none;user-select:none;-webkit-background-clip:text;background-clip:text;flex-shrink:0;align-items:flex-start;min-width:90px;padding-top:.25rem;font-size:4.5rem;font-weight:900;line-height:1;transition:opacity .4s;display:flex}.value-item:hover .value-number{opacity:.7}.value-accent{opacity:.4;background:linear-gradient(#38bdf8,#0056b3);border-radius:3px;flex-shrink:0;width:3px;transition:opacity .4s,box-shadow .4s}.value-item:hover .value-accent{opacity:1;box-shadow:0 0 15px #38bdf866}.value-content{flex-direction:column;justify-content:center;padding:.5rem 0;display:flex}.value-icon-modern{color:#38bdf8;background:#38bdf81a;border:1px solid #38bdf833;border-radius:12px;justify-content:center;align-items:center;width:48px;height:48px;margin-bottom:1.25rem;transition:all .4s;display:flex}.value-item:hover .value-icon-modern{background:#38bdf833;border-color:#38bdf866;transform:scale(1.1);box-shadow:0 0 20px #38bdf826}.value-content h3{color:#f1f5f9;margin-bottom:.75rem;font-size:1.5rem;font-weight:800;transition:color .3s}.value-item:hover .value-content h3{color:#fff}.value-content p{color:#94a3b8;font-size:1.05rem;line-height:1.75;transition:color .3s}.value-item:hover .value-content p{color:#cbd5e1}@media (max-width:768px){.value-item{gap:1.5rem}.value-number{min-width:60px;font-size:3rem}.values-title{font-size:2rem}}@media (max-width:992px){.story-grid{grid-template-columns:1fr;gap:4rem}}
